Abstract: A glycoprotein isolated from Aloe, a plant belonging to Liliaceae, having a molecular weight of 1.8.times.10.sup.4 and a ratio of protein to sugar of 8 to 2 by weight; yielding only a single band upon SDS-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is without 2-mercaptoethanol treatment and yielding two discrete bands upon SDS-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is with 2-mercaptoethanol treatment; having hemagglutinating and cytoagglutinating activity for transformed cells; having mitogenic activity for lymphocytes, cap forming activity for lymphocytes and cultured transformed cells using fluorescence labeled glycoprotein; having binding reactivity with some types of serum proteins; and having the capability of activating complement components.
